Comparative history is a category of books that studies and explains historical phenomena by comparing different societies, time periods, regions, or institutions to reveal patterns, contrasts, and causes that single-case narratives may miss. These works use side-by-side case studies, thematic cross-national surveys, or transnational approaches to explore topics like revolutions, state formation, migration, economy, gender, or empire-building, seeking general insights about why similar events unfolded differently (or why different events show similar dynamics). Authors in this genre emphasize method — careful selection of comparable cases, attention to context, and awareness of sources and bias — to draw cautious generalizations, test hypotheses, and refine historical theories. Comparative history books can be scholarly or accessible to general readers and are valuable for anyone wanting a broader, analytic perspective on how human societies change and interact over time.
